Crema's Take

Easy Luck feels like the kind of place where you can linger for hours without feeling rushed, whether you're meeting friends or settling in with your laptop. Their creative specialty drinks—like the Bananaman Latte that tastes like freshly baked banana bread and unique blends like blueberry coffee—showcase real craft, and the kitchen backs that up with thoughtfully made food including vegan and gluten-free options. It's genuinely welcoming and inclusive, with a modern hipster charm and staff who remember how you like your order, making it easy to see why locals keep coming back.
